R11 - Bad bind

A process performed an incorrect TCP socket bind. This error is often caused by binding to a port other than the assigned $PORT. It can also be caused by binding to an interface other than 0.0.0.0 or *.

2011-05-03T17:38:16+00:00 heroku[web.1]: Starting process with command: bundle exec ruby web.rb -e production
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 app[web.1]: == Sinatra/1.2.3 has taken the stage on 4567 for production with backup from Thin
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 app[web.1]: >> Thin web server
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 app[web.1]: >> Maximum connections set to 1024
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 app[web.1]: >> Listening on 0.0.0.0:4567, CTRL+C to stop
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 heroku[web.1]: Error R11 (Bad bind) -> Process bound to port 4567, should be 43411 (see environment variable PORT)
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 heroku[web.1]: Stopping process with SIGKILL
2011-05-03T17:38:18+00:00 heroku[web.1]: Process exited
2011-05-03T17:38:20+00:00 heroku[web.1]: State changed from starting to crashed
